Kimmon Warodom Khemmonta is a Thai actor, singer, and emcee. He graduated from Wat Songtham School and later studied in the Faculty of Education of Thonburi Rajabhat University. Kim debuted as an actor in the 2015 series "Love Sick 2" and is best known for playing the lead role of Ming in the 2017 series "2 Moons". In 2018, he was launched as leader and vocalist of the Thai boy pop group SBFIVE.
